Many schools throughout the United States are now employing coaches to support teachers in the teaching of mathematics.

Very often, these are professionals selected from the current teaching ranks who did not receive any special training to serve as a coach.

This book provides the skills, knowledge, and lessons from experience that lead such a mentor to function effectively.

Aside from describing the basic duties of an effective math coach, we also provide a plethora of resources to enrich instruction, improve problem-solving direction, and provide teachers with a wide variety of techniques to enhance their teaching effectiveness.
